Sporting Lisbon v Newcastle photos
1 of 10
Newcastle get off to a great start when Kieron Dyer fires home to give the Magpies the crucial away goal advantage
2 of 10
Dyer celebrates with team-mate Jermaine Jenas after scoring against Sporting Lisbon
3 of 10
Newcastle's Charles N'Zogbia battles with Sporting Lisbon's Joao Moutinho as the visitors look to add to their goal tally
4 of 10
Dyer has the chance to net a brace but fails to capitalise on the opportunity much to the relief of Sporting's goalkeeper
5 of 10
Marius Niculae is congratulated by Joao Moutinho after his superb header levels the game to give the home side a lifeline
6 of 10
Newcastle captain Alan Shearer vies for the ball with Sporting's Anderson Polga as the second half gets underway
7 of 10
However it's the Portuguese side who take control scoring twice in quick succession thanks to Sa Pinto and Beto
8 of 10
Beto kisses his shirt after scoring Sporting's third goal as the home side move closer to claiming a semi-final spot
9 of 10
There is further woe for the Magpies when Fabio Rochemback slides the ball past Shay Given to end Newcastle's dreams
10 of 10
Lee Bowyer looks on dejectedly as Sporting celebrate making the most of Newcastle's sloppiness to win 4-2 on aggregate
